You will need about 1700 – 1800 metres of DK weight yarn to make a blanket that is the given size below. You can also use a different yarn weight to make a smaller or larger blanket, using a matching hook – bear in mind your yardage requirements will vary. You can make a larger blanket by adding more stitches…all explained in notes. Flexible pattern and perfect stashbuster!

I made this blanket with Deramores Studio DK yarn – a very soft 100% acrylic yarn, with lovely stitch definition and the most gorgeous colours. You can find all the details for the yarn on Dereamores web site.
